Redazione uicparma.it
L'HTML in pillole

Logo UIC Parma-Club

Quarta pillola - I collegamenti ipertestuali o link.

Senza almeno un link una pagina HTML non ha molto senso. Viene cioè meno la sua caratteristica principale, l'ipertestualità.
Qui distingueremo solo un paio di tipologie di link testuali, e cioè quelli assoluti e quelli relativi.
nel primo caso si tratta di link che contengono l'intero percorso ad una pagina web, mentre nel secondo si tratta della sola indicazione del nome del documento senza specificare il drive o il sito in cui si trova.
Per meglio intenderci,

http://www.uicparma.it/index.htm
è un link assoluto, mentre
corsi/index.htm
è un link relativo.

Chiarito questo primo punto, passiamo a descrivere come si realizza un link.
Vediamo innanzitutto da cosa è composto.
Il primo elemento è il codice <A HREF="...">.
Il secondo elemento è l'indirizzo da scrivere all'interno del codice qui sopra, sostituendo i puntini che si trovano tra le virgolette.
Successivamente troviamo il testo che descrive il contenuto del link e che scriverai dopo il codice.
Infine, dopo il testo descrittivo, chiuderemo il link con il codice </A>.
Cosa te ne pare? Dici che e' un po' confuso?
Allora proviamo con il consueto esempio...

<H1> Unione Italiana Ciechi </H1>
sezione di Parma<BR>
Club informatico<BR>
via Bixio, 47/a <BR>
<P>
Visita il <A HREF="http://www.uiciechi.it">sito nazionale</A> dell'Unione Italiana Ciechi.<BR>
Preleva i <A HREF="corsi.htm">corsi on line</A><BR>
</P>
Fine esempio.

Analizziamo ora quanto abbiamo aggiunto alla pagina.
Si tratta di due link, uno assoluto ed uno relativo.
Il primo si riferisce ad un sito esterno a quello su cui si lavora, mentre il secondo fa riferimento ad una risorsa presente nel tuo spazio web.
Per quanto riguarda il link relativo all'Unione nazionale, comespiegato precedentemente, è stato inserito l'intero indirizzo tra le virgolette presenti all'interno dell'apposito codice, ed il testo "sito nazionale" sarà quello che il sintetizzatore vocalizzerà come collegamento.
La pagina dei corsi indicata nel nostro esempio, invece, si trova nel tuo spazio web ed esattamente allo stesso livello in cui si trova la pagina che stai scrivendo.
E come fare se la pagina che vuoi linkare si trova in un'altra cartella?
Nessun problema...
Dovremo indicare il percorso specificando le cartelle.
Supponiamo quindi che tu abbia posizionato la pagina dei corsi all'interno della cartella club-informatico che si trova ad un livello inferiore rispetto alla pagina di partenza.
Dovrai quindi scrivere:
Preleva i <A HREF="club-informatico/corsi.htm">corsi on line.</A>
E se volessimo tornare indietro, ovvero se volessimo andare ad una pagina di un livello superiore, come potremmo fare?
E' semplicissimo...
Supponiamo di essere in fase di redazione della pagina "corsi.htm" contenuta all'interno di "club-informatico", e di voler inserire un collegamento alla nostra home page che si trova nella principale, quindi ad un livello superiore.
Scriveremo quanto segue:

<A HREF="../index.htm">Torna alla home page</A>

La pagina che vogliamo linkare si chiama "index.htm", e i due punti seguiti dalla barra "../" stanno ad indicare che si trova nella cartella superiore. Qualora la pagina da linkare si trovasse a due livelli superiori dovremmo utilizzare il comando ../../ e così via...
Tieni comunque conto che, per poter visualizzare le tue pagine su di uno spazio web, ti sarà necessario chiamare index.htm la tua home page, che dovrà trovarsi sempre nella radice del tuo sito.

L'ultima cosa che ti segnaliamo in questa "pillola" è il link per l'invio di posta.
Da una pagina HTML è infatti possibile far sì che si apra il mailer del visitatore per compilare un messaggio da inviare. Quindi, se vorrai farti scrivere dai tuoi visitatori, potrai usare la stringa seguente:

<A HREF="mailto:master@miosito.it">Scrivi al master</A>

Ovviamente sostituirai l'indirizzo master@miosito.it con l'indirizzo al quale vuoi far scrivere il tuo visitatore, e "Scrivi al master" con altro testo di tuo gradimento.

Ricorda che dopo il codice </A> sarà opportuno inserire il codice <BR> per attivare il ritorno a capo. In caso contrario ti troveresti tutti i link su di una sola riga.

Ed ora passiamo a curare un po' di più gli aspetti estetici delle tue pagine HTML.

Pillola successiva
Pillola precedente
Indice

Torna alla Home Page

Scrivi alla redazione del sito



[ Copyright © 1999 - 2002 UIC Parma-Club ]